In recent years, quiet quitting has emerged as a major and worrying trend in the business world. Essentially, quiet quitting involves employees doing the bare minimum in their role and engaging less at work. This is problematic in many ways because it can see dips in performance in productivity, impact the company culture and morale, and lead to tension in the workplace.
